Executive Abstract
An internal interview is used for the same purpose as an external one: to find someone to fill an empty position. It can also be a promotion interview, where the candidate has applied for a higher position within the company they work for. Many employers are happy that their employees are choosing to stay in the company and want to see them grow and succeed.
